.284 Winchester vs .30-378 Weatherby
A to-scale size comparison of the .284 Winchester and the .30-378 Weatherby, drawn from SAAMI and C.I.P. cartridge dimensions and aligned at the case head.
.284 Winchester (left) beside .30-378 Weatherby (right), shown at the same scale.
The .284 Winchester has an overall length of about 2.80″ with a 0.284″ bullet. The .30-378 Weatherby runs about 3.75″ on a 0.308″ bullet. That makes the .30-378 Weatherby about 1.3x the overall length of the .284 Winchester. See the full reference for each: .284 Winchester and .30-378 Weatherby.
